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) has revoked the operating licence of Skye Bank Plc with immediate effect. The apex bank’s Governor, Godwin Emefiele, made this known during a press briefing in Lagos, Nigeria’s commercial city, on Friday. Emefiele said Skye Bank would now be taken over by Polaris Bank, which would take charge of all the assets and liabilities of the defunct entity.

The CBN maintained that customers’ deposits were safe as management and members of staff will be retained under the new ownership structure. In the meantime, the share price of Skye Bank on Friday moved up 4.05 percent at 77 kobo.
